Stretching Exercises
to prevent Injury


Stretching exercises are important warm up and cool down routines for any exercise or sport's program. Stretching has many benefits:

  • It can prevent injury and increase coordination and balance.
  • Performance and posture can be improved with proper stretching routines.
  • It can improve blood circulation.
  • It can strengthen all muscles.



Before performing a stretching routine, it is beneficial to do some activity that uses many of the large muscles of the body such as walking. This increases the temperature of the muscles and will make stretching more comfortable.

The stretching routine should be done before and after the workout and should last about 5-10 minutes.
